Web8 de jan. de 2007 · The verb is ' to look forward to ' = ' to anticipate ' (transitive = requires a direct object). So, the direct object should be the gerund (noun) form of the verb ' to meet ', i.e. meeting. In contrast: " I'm waiting to meet you ". ryan smith. +4. Only #2 is correct. The phrasal verb ' look forward to ' must be followed by a noun or, as in this ...
